We are looking for a reliable and experienced Head Housekeeper to lead our housekeeping team at Woodlands Care Centre, based in Cambridge to ensure our care home maintains the highest standards of cleanliness, comfort, and safety for our residents. As Head Housekeeper, you will play a vital role in creating a warm, welcoming, and hygienic environment that supports the dignity and well-being of everyone in our care.
Key Responsibilities- Manage and support a team of housekeeping staff to maintain high cleanliness standards throughout the home
- Create and maintain cleaning schedules and ensure compliance with infection control protocols
- Conduct regular audits and inspections to ensure cleanliness and presentation meet care quality standards
- Order and manage housekeeping supplies within budget
- Work closely with care and maintenance teams to ensure a well-run and pleasant environment
- Previous experience in a housekeeping supervisory role, ideally in a care home or healthcare setting
- Strong attention to detail and high standards of hygiene
- Good organisational and leadership skills
- Friendly, approachable, and able to lead by example
- Understanding of infection prevention and control standards in a care environment
